Rose Good Abrahamson, age 93, a beloved wife and mother and a fourth generation Skagit Valley resident, passed away after a brief illness Wednesday, February 16, 2005 at the Life Care Center of Skagit Valley in Sedro-Woolley. She was born April 5, 1911 in Burlington, WA the daughter of Arthur and Mable Warfield Good. Rose was a resident of Sedro-Woolley for the past 45 years. She is survived by her husband of 69 years Ed Abrahamson of the family home in Sedro-Woolley. Her son Doug Abrahamson of Big Lake and a daughter Sandy Abrahamson of Sedro-Woolley. 4 grandchildren Jennifer, Steve, Stephanie, and Angie and 2 great grandchildren Kellen and Kailee Rose. A sister Esther Richmeyer of Concrete.
She was preceded in death by her daughter Carol, her son Edwin, 4 brothers Allen ‘Bus’ Good, Armine ‘Tat’ Good, Weldon ‘Bubs’ Good, and Homer ‘Duck’ Good and a sister Freda Parker.
